Following diagram clearly explains that how these technologies work together to develop a web application. Ive also been in web development for not too long tutorial for how to use the mean stack. Ive recently been introduced to the mean stack, and im liking the idea of it havent started using it to use it so far. The mean stack is a full javascript framework and acronym for mongodb, expressjs. Answers in stack overflow by sdude in apr 21, 2014. Mean stack is basically a collection of javascriptbased web devleopment technologies that includes mongodb, expressjs, angularjs and nodejs.
Mar 16, 2017 a couple years ago i dove into web development. Storing and retrieving files from mongodb using mean stack. Every application needs to store its data at some point be it in a database or a file system. Getting started with basics of building your own cloud. Its taken me a while, but ive finally gone through and sorted them all. Its very clear that mean is targeting all kinds of javascript developers both server and client side and also that it is a stack platform which, indicates that there are several components comprising it. Mean stack angular 5 crud web application example by didin j. The whole point is to add a backend integration to our angular frontend app. A practical guide to planning a mean stack application is an excerpt from mannings getting mean with mongo, express, angular, and node, second edition.
This is how the authors of the mean stack define it on their website. Learn to build modern web applications using the mean stack. This is an application demonstrating the basic components needed for a single page application using mongodb, expressjs, angularjs, and nodejs. By completing this tutorial, you will gain a basic understanding of the mean stack including building a rest interface with express. The following web sites are good starting points for learning javascript. Were going to make use of a mean stack template from to get up and running.
Additionally, a youtube tutorial series illustrating how to create this application from scratch can be found here. Pdf simplifying web application development usingmean stack. Top 20 angularjs interview questions must have web. A mean stack tutorial where you wil build a realworld application. At this point, everything is ready to create a powerful. The goal of this tutorial is to guide you through the creation of a reddithacker news clone using the mean stack. Connecting a backend api to an angular frontend application tutorial. Mean is an acronym that stands for m ongodb, e xpress, n ode.
The tutorial is for beginners and will get you started quickly. You can solve for the mean and the variance anyway. It was basically developed to solve the common issues with connecting those frameworks mongo, express nodejs, angularjs, build a robust framework to support daily. The goal of this tutorial is to guide you through the coding of a full stack javascript example application project and connecting a backend api to an angular 7 frontend application employing the mean stack. Understanding each individual components of open stack and its functionality with basic architecture. A mean stack tutorial where you will build a realworld application. We are going to release practical scenario based web applications using mean stack for our readers in coming weeks. Heres an awesome onestop resource about the mean stack, including why youd choose it and how to set everything up.
Learn how to build a mean stack application with this angular. Every application needs to store its data at some point be it in a database or. The goal of this tutorial is to guide you through the coding of a fullstack javascript example application project and connecting a backend api to an angular 7 frontend application employing the mean stack. Js is a full stack javascript solution that helps you build fast, robust, and maintainable production web applications using mongodb, express, angularjs, and node. Apr 03, 2017 mean stack tutorial 2 mean stack codevolution. Jul 17, 2017 a practical guide to planning a mean stack application is an excerpt from mannings getting mean with mongo, express, angular, and node, second edition.
Javascript has exploded in recent years and has moved from the frontend on the serverside. Angular 8 crud example angular 8 tutorial for beginners. This tutorial is designed for software programmers who want to learn the basics of meanjs and its programming concepts in simple and easy ways. There is a possibility that this content has been removed from the given url or may be this site has been shut down completely. Meanjs is useful for this tutorial since it provides an app structure and has its own templates for scaffolding components.
The mean mongodb expressjs angularjs nodejs stack utilizes javascript as its. Up to this point, what we have is a skeleton for frontend project and a skeleton for a backend. Finding the mean and variance from pdf stack exchange. Stack is an abstract data type with a bounded predefined capacity. The mean stack is mongodb, express, angular and nodejs. A full stack web developer is a person who can develop both client and server software. From client to server to database, mean is full stack javascript. Fortunately, heres a brand spanking new tutorial that will provide you with a working mean4 and soon, mean5. Mean has gained popularity because it allows developers to program in javascript on both the client and the server. Mean stack tutorial, question, answer, example, java, javascript, sql, c, android, interview, quiz, ajax, html. In other words, it means that you can start a screen session and then open any number of windows. The main point learnt during this project is that the technology chosen is not nearly as. Its not only helpful for an interview but also for developing professional angularjs applications.
The mean stack represents a thoroughly modern approach to web development. A practical guide to planning a mean stack application. Mern is full form of mongodb, express, react, node. In this series, we will build together a video player mean stack application. Learn to build modern web apps with mean thinkster. Mean stack there are two wellknown full stack javascript framework for mea which are created by the same person amos haviv. Mean stack there are two wellknown fullstack javascript framework for mea which are created by the same person amos haviv. The application was rewritten using the mean stack mongodb, expressjs.
Jun 24, 2019 the elk stack helps by providing users with a powerful platform that collects and processes data from multiple data sources, stores that data in one centralized data store that can scale as data grows, and that provides a set of tools to analyze the data. Oct 16, 2016 a comprehensive list of angularjs interview questions and detailed answers that takes developer from entrylevel to an experienced one by discussing core concepts with code samples. An emerging stack thats gaining much attention and excitement in the web community is the mean stack. So far, i know the basics on nodejs, and mongodb through meteorjs. Program a browser like using javascript, jquery, angular, or vue program a server like using php, asp, python, or node program a database like using sql, sqlite, or mongodb client software. If you buy something we get a small commission at no extra charge to you. As my knowledge continues to grow, ive realized i have a plethora of free information that ive saved along the way. Every time an element is added, it goes on the top of the stack and the only element that can be removed is the element that is at the top of the stack, just like a pile of objects. The mean stack enables a perfect harmony of javascript object notation json development. Pdf version quick guide resources job search discussion the term mean. In addition to mastering html and css, heshe also knows how to. Jan 25, 2017 hopefully, this mean stack development tutorial will be a complete reference for mean stack web application development for developers. Learn how to build a mean stack application with this.
Mean is an acronym that stands for mongodb, express, node. Mean stack tutorial beginners tutorial bradley braithwaite. Let me tell you how they work together, angular is acually use for front end. Aug 10, 2017 within 2017, angular will have gone from version 2, to 4, and ultimately to 5 in september. Mean stack tutorials mongodb, express, angular, node youtube. Learn how to build a mean stack application with this angular tutorial. Mean stack tutorial application this is an application demonstrating the basic components needed for a single page application using mongodb, expressjs, angularjs, and nodejs. Mean is a fullstack javascript platform for modern web applications. Mean is an acronym for mongodb, expressjs, angularjs and node. Storing and retrieving files from mongodb using mean stack and gridfs.
Being last doesnt mean that its the least importantits actually the foundation of the stack. Sep 18, 2017 build full stack web apps with mevn stack part 12. Mean stack is basically a collection of javascriptbased web development technologies that includes mongodb, expressjs, angularjs and nodejs. He introduced the term in a 20 blog post the logo concept, initially created by austin anderson for the original mean stack linkedin group, is an assembly of the first letter of each component of the mean acronym. See, for example, mean and variance for a binomial use summation instead of integrals for discrete random variables. Jul 31, 2019 the mean stack is a popular web development stack made up of mongodb, express, angular, and node. In its own words its an opensource fullstack solution for mean applications. Lamp stack linux server on which youre running an apache web server with mysql as a database and php as the backend language. It is a simple data structure that allows adding and removing elements in a particular order. Jan 24, 2014 this next tutorial will teach us that and then we can go further in depth of how to build the frontend angular application to consume our new api. Because of this, it has been difficult for developers to find reliable mean configurations that will work with the latest version of angular. Js will help you getting started and avoid useless grunt work and common pitfalls, while keeping your application organized. Create a web app and restful api server using the mean stack. Open stack tutorial for beginners,to get started with building your own private cloud.